Pawtucket Man Charged With Stealing More Than $10K In Property: Cops

He was also charge with accessing a computer for fraudulent purposes, police said.

PAWTUCKET, RI — A Pawtucket man was charged with stealing more than $10,000 worth of property, police said.

Yuldor Salazar, 35, was arrested about noon Sept. 7 on charges of accessing a computer for fraudulent purposes and obtaining more than $10,000 worth of property by false pretenses, the Rhode Island State Police said in a media release.

Salazar surrendered at state police headquarters, where he was processed, arraigned by a justice of the police and released with a court date, according to police.
